.ban{background:linear-gradient(-45deg,#ee7752,#e73c7e,#23a6d5,#23d5ab);-webkit-background-clip:text;-webkit-text-fill-color:transparent;animation:gradient 10s ease infinite;background-clip:text;background-size:400% 400%;color:transparent;display:inline-block}@keyframes gradient{0%{background-position:0 50%}50%{background-position:100% 50%}to{background-position:0 50%}}@media(prefers-reduced-motion:reduce){.ban{animation:none}}@media(prefers-contrast:high){.text-ds-purple{color:#000!important;text-shadow:1px 1px 0 #fff}}.compatibility-section[data-v-3e192962],.coverage-section[data-v-3e192962],.faq-section[data-v-3e192962],.features-section[data-v-3e192962],.hero-section[data-v-3e192962],.promotional-section[data-v-3e192962],.steps-section[data-v-3e192962]{scroll-margin-top:2rem}[data-v-3e192962]:focus-visible{outline:2px solid #6366f1;outline-offset:2px}
